The Verdict

Ultimately, the choice between Live Dealer and RNG games depends on individual preferences. For players seeking a more immersive and social experience, Live Dealer games may be the ideal choice. Conversely, those who prefer faster gameplay and a broader variety of titles might find RNG games more appealing. Both types have their merits and drawbacks, making it essential for players to understand the differences before placing their bets.

The Good

  • Live Dealer Games:
    • Real-time interaction with dealers and players enhances the gaming experience.
    • Authenticity of the casino environment, akin to physical casinos.
    • Games are streamed in high-definition, ensuring clarity and engagement.
  • RNG Games:
    • Wide variety of game types, including slots, table games, and more.
    • Faster gameplay, with no waiting for other players or dealers.
    • Higher Return to Player (RTP) percentages in some instances, often exceeding 96%.

The Bad

  • Live Dealer Games:
    • Higher minimum bets compared to RNG games, often starting at £5 or more.
    • Dependent on internet speed; a poor connection can disrupt gameplay.
    • Limited availability of games compared to the vast selection of RNG titles.
  • RNG Games:
    • Lack of social interaction can feel isolating for some players.
    • Games may lack the authenticity of a real dealer experience.
    • Potential for a less engaging experience due to automated play.
